Big Brownie Sundae
ABSOLUTELY, you can make this mini brownie into a macho size! A very common size iron skillet in everyone's kitchen cabinet is the 10 or 12 inch size. If you do not have a mini skillet and instead would just like to use what you have I completely understand. Luckily, it is very simple to convert this skillet brownie recipe to accommodate a larger skillet.
Plus, more yummy skillet brownie so that is always a win. Simply double all of the ingredients of the recipe and follow the exact same prep steps. Also, keep the same baking temperature; but extend the cook time. I would start with baking the skillet brownie for 30 minutes and checking it and adding an additional 5 minutes if needed. It is finished baking when a toothpick comes out mostly clean, so just go by that.

Common Questions
How should leftover brownies be stored?
IF (let's be real there won't be any brownies left) you have leftover chocolate brownies you can store covered at room temperature for up to 7 days. If you have put ice cream or other dairy products on top then you would need to discard of any leftover brownies.
Can brownies be frozen?
Alternatively, you could freeze the brownie sundae for up to 1 month. Place in a freezer safe container or wrap in foil. Let the chocolate brownie de-thaw in the fridge, or microwave the brownie for 30-60 seconds until warmed through.

Skillet Brownie Sundae for Two
Caitlyn Erhardt
This Skillet Brownie for Two is the perfect indulgent treat for a date-night in or Valentine's Day. Top with your favorite toppings for the perfect finish!

Prep Time 10 minutes mins
Cook Time 20 minutes mins
Total Time 30 minutes mins
Course Dessert, Snack, Treat
Cuisine American, Valentines Day
Servings 2 People
Calories 380 kcal
Ingredients
- 4 tablespoon Unsalted Butter Melted
- ¼ Cup Granulated White Sugar
- ¾ teaspoon Vanilla Extract
- 1 Egg
- 3 tablespoon Unsweetened Cocoa Powder
- 1 tablespoon All Purpose Flour
- ⅛ teaspoon Salt
- ⅛ teaspoon Baking Powder
- ¼ Cup Chocolate Chips Plus More for Topping
Optional Toppings
- Sliced Strawberries
- Hot Fudge
- Vanilla Ice Cream
- Whipped Cream
Instructions
Preheat oven to 350 degrees. In a medium sized bowl combine melted butter and sugar and whisk for 1 minute. Next, add in the vanilla extract and egg and whisk for another 1-2 minutes. I used a hand whisk, but you could also use and electric mixer.
Add in remaining ingredients and stir until just combined. Do not over stir the batter, this will help give the brownie a fudgey texture. Once combined add to a buttered 5-6 inch iron skillet, top with extra chocolate chips if desired.
Bake on the center rack for 20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out mostly clean. Serve warm and top with optional toppings if desired. Enjoy!
